I came up with an idea, let me know what you guys think!
To rent the 500mm II is $375 for 4 days.
To rent the 600mm II is $506 for 4 days.
To rent the 500mm I is $262 for 4 days.
Since we know that the IQ of both version II Super-telephotos will be outstanding and one of our main concerns is weight and hand-holdability, then how about renting the 500mm Version 1, which is about the same weight as the 600mm II. If 500mm Version 1 is too heavy then we know that 500mm II will be more acceptable. I've heard a lot of people of say that the older 500 feels like the newer 600.
However, since the 600mm II is approx 2.5 inches longer than the 500mm II which will affect swing weight, what if we just add the 2X extender to the older 500mm I, then we could increase the length of the 500mm by about the same length difference as the new 600mmII.
I know it wont be exact, but I think it's a good way of not spending too much money on renting and testing, as $262 plus insurance and shipping is at least reasonable.
